Has anyone tried an active cooling solution for the 5th gen max? What is available? Would it need to be custom made? What's involved in installing one w/ a vortech s/c?

Looking for info.
Want greater gains than an CAI can provide.

Intercooler will do you no good for an N/A car. You won't need an intercooer if you're running 6 psi (stock) for the Vortech S/C. You probably don't even need it if you run 10 psi.

You'll need to drilling holes to get one to fit... it's going to need quite a bit of customization.
